Paraformaldehyde has a strong smell of formaldehyde. The dissolution temperature when the degree of polymerization n is 8-12 is 80℃, and the dissolution temperature when the degree of polymerization n is above 12 is 120-170℃. It is insoluble in ethanol, but soluble in dilute acid. And dilute alkali solution, it decomposes quickly when melted, but it does not have some mechanical properties of plastic, and it cannot process film. This kind of low-polymerization products are unstable polymers and are easily dissolved into formaldehyde solutions. For example, in the production of amino synthetic resin coatings, in order to avoid the use of formalin with high water content, low-polymerization paraformaldehyde is usually used. Using low polymerization degree paraformaldehyde instead of ordinary industrial formaldehyde aqueous solution, in the synthesis of pesticides, synthetic resins, coatings and fumigation disinfectants and other various downstream products of formaldehyde, it can not only reduce the energy consumption of dehydration, but also greatly reduce the waste water. Processing capacity, this is a green environmental protection project that benefits the country and the people. Paraformaldehyde with low polymerization degree is a solid particle because it has higher effective components than industrial formaldehyde, which is beneficial to chemical synthesis and other industrial applications such as chemical industry and pharmacy. Especially in the synthesis that requires the use of anhydrous formaldehyde as a raw material, it has a wide range of uses. . It can also be used as a disinfectant, bactericide, fumigant and herbicide, and to make resin and artificial ivory. Some products are shown in the figure below.
